Decided I'd start making some turkey tail fan plaques again.  These are made out of rustic barn wood, and are a nice way to display your tail fan and beard. 

I don't have any made right now, but I will be making a few next week, so I will have them to you shortly if you order one.

I can also make different shaped ones, so if you find something online you like, let me know and I will see if I can make it!  For instance, I can do one that has a box call lid for the bottom piece, or depending on the state, I can make a state for the top piece.  Only so many states' shape work well for that though (Iowa, Ohio, Missouri, Texas, Wisconsin, etc..)

Quote from: Eddie12 on April 21, 2016, 01:30:30 PM
Tagged...these look really nice might have to get one. Is there a way to hang the spurs using a piece of leather or something around the beard? Thanks.

Hot glue leather to back of the plaque, run it through leg bone, cut plastic off a fired shell, punch primer out and hot glue other end of leather inside the brass. Works really well.
